Co to są płatności cykliczne w PayU
Płatności cykliczne w PayU pozwalają Twoim klientom automatycznie odnawiać dostęp do kursu - np. co miesiąc, co kwartał lub co rok.Dzięki temu nie muszą pamiętać o kolejnych wpłatach - system pobiera je sam, z zapisanej wcześniej karty.
Możliwe jest też pobieranie użycia karty, online, o czym przeczytasz tutaj:
https://poznaj.publigo.pl/articles/238975-jak-wczy-pautomatczne-patnoci-cykliczne
1. Wymagania wstępne
Zanim włączysz płatności cykliczne w Publigo:- Podpisz umowę z PayU - jeśli jeszcze jej nie masz.
- Aktywuj konto handlowe w PayU.
- Poproś PayU o włączenie usług OneClick i Recurring - te dwie funkcje są niezbędne, żeby system mógł pobierać płatności cykliczne z kart klientów.
Ważne!
Aby płatności cykliczne działały prawidłowo, należy wpisać “Tytuł witryny” w WordPressie:
- Wejdź w Kokpit → Ustawienia → Ogólne.
- W polu “Tytuł witryny” wpisz nazwę swojego serwisu (np. “Szkoła Zosi”, “Akademia Online”, “Akademia Jogi Marty Kowalskiej”).
Pole "Tytuł witryny" nie może być puste - jeśli będzie puste, operator nie rozpozna witryny i płatności cykliczne nie przejdą walidacji.
2. Integracja z PayU
Po włączeniu usług przez PayU:- Wejdź w Publigo w Ustawienia → Główne → Sposoby płatności
- Włącz PayU i kliknij “Konfiguruj”
- Uzupełnij dane:
- Id punktu płatności (pos_id) - wprowadź Id punktu płatności (pos_id). Znajdziesz go w panelu administracyjnym Pay U -> Płatności elektroniczne -> Moje sklepy -> Punkty płatności
- Drugi klucz (MD5) - wprowadź drugi klucz (MD5).
Znajdziesz go w panelu administracyjnym PayU -> Płatności elektroniczne -> Moje sklepy -> Punkty płatności - Środowisko PayU API - wybierz środowisko PayU API. Pamiętaj, że każde środowisko ma swoje klucze, które trzeba zmienić. "Sandbox" służy do testów, a "Secure" umożliwia rzeczywiste płatności.
- Płatności cykliczne - zaznacz jeżeli chcesz, aby klient mógł dokonywać płatności cyklicznych za pośrednictwem karty bankowej, przelewu online, bądź zaznacz oba.
- Włącz możliwość zmiany karty - zaznacz, jeśli chcesz, by klient mógł dokonać samodzielnej zmiany karty płatniczej
- Włącz tryb diagnostyczny - zaznacz, jeżeli chcesz gromadzić dodatkowe informacje
- Nazwa metody płatności - dowolna nazwa metody płatności.
- BLIK na stronie Zamówienie - włącz możliwość bezpośredniej płatności BLIKiem
- Zapisz zmiany.
3. Włączenie płatności cyklicznych dla kursu
Po poprawnym skonfigurowaniu PayU, płatności cykliczne ustawisz w wariantach wybranego kursu:- Kliknij w zakładkę "Kursy"
- Wybierz odpowiedni kurs
- W "Podstawowe", na dole strony znajdziesz "Warianty"
- Wybierz edycję danego wariantu (ikonka z ołówkiem z prawej strony)
- W pojawiającym się okienku ustaw "Płatności cykliczne" - Tak
- Dostosuj ilość cykli płatniczych i okres płatności
- Zapisz wybrane ustawienia
4. Testy (środowisko Sandbox)
Zanim uruchomisz sprzedaż, warto przetestować integrację w środowisku testowym (Sandbox). Dzięki temu sprawdzisz, czy płatności przebiegają poprawnie i dane się zapisują.Aby sprawdzić poprawność integracji przed uruchomieniem sprzedaży:
- Utwórz konto testowe w PayU Sandbox: https://developers.payu.com/europe/pl/docs/testing/sandbox/
- W Publigo w sekcji Bramki płatności → PayU wpisz dane testowe:
POS ID: 300746
Second key (MD5): b6ca15b0d1020e8094d9b5f8d163db54 - Zmień środowisko API na Sandbox (testowe).
- Zapisz zmiany.
- Wykonaj testowy zakup, by sprawdzić, czy płatność przebiega poprawnie.
5. Zmiana karty przez klienta
Szczegółowa instrukcja znajduje się tutaj:https://poznaj.publigo.pl/articles/236321-jak-uruchomi-samodzieln-zmian-karty-w-payu-i-tpay
Jeśli masz włączoną opcję „samodzielnej zmiany karty” (dla PayU lub Tpay), klient może zmienić dane karty bezpośrednio z poziomu swojego konta.
W przeciwnym razie, zmiana karty wymaga anulowania starej subskrypcji i utworzenia nowego zamówienia.
6. Spóźniona płatność
Jeśli klient spóźni się z płatnością cykliczną, system automatycznie odcina dostęp po terminie, a nowy okres dostępu liczony jest od dnia, w którym płatność faktycznie wpłynie.Przykład:
Termin płatności: 4 listopada
Klient nie zapłacił w terminie - dostęp został automatycznie wstrzymany
Klient opłacił subskrypcję dopiero 28 listopada
--> System przywraca dostęp od dnia opłacenia (28 listopada) i ustawia nowy termin kolejnej płatności na 28 grudnia.
--> W praktyce oznacza to, że klient NIE zyskuje dodatkowych dni, ponieważ między 4 a 28 listopada nie miał aktywnego dostępu do kursu.
Jeśli w kolejnym miesiącu klient zapłaci znów w terminie (np. 28 grudnia), system utrzyma ten nowy rytm płatności.
Natomiast jeśli wróci do płatności 4 stycznia, cykl automatycznie powróci do pierwotnego terminu (4. dnia miesiąca).
7. Ważne zasady
- Pierwsza płatność musi wynosić co najmniej 1 zł, aby system zapisał dane karty.
- W formularzu zamówienia muszą być aktywne pola Imię i Nazwisko.
- Jeśli ustawisz rabat i nie zaznaczysz opcji „jednorazowy dla danego klienta”, każda kolejna płatność będzie pobierana po cenie promocyjnej.
- Kolejne płatności pobierane są po północy (z niewielkim wyprzedzeniem).
- Operatorzy płatności pobierają prowizję zarówno za uruchomienie płatności cyklicznych, jak i od każdej transakcji.